A motorcyclist suffered serious injuries following a crash on the Isle of Wight’s Military Road yesterday evening (Monday).

At around 6.25pm, police were called to the scene following reports of a two-vehicle crash.

The collision involved a motorcycle and a car.

The rider of the motorcycle, a man in his 50s, suffered serious injuries and was taken to Southampton General Hospital for treatment, police have confirmed.

The collision happened near Freshwater Bay Golf Club, overlooking Freshwater Bay, and involved a Citroen Nemo and a motorcycle.

Needles Coastguard Rescue Team were en route to training on Military Road at the time of the collision and stopped to provide initial casualty care.

The road was closed in both directions for a time while emergency teams dealt with the incident.
